Abstract

PURPOSE: To prepare a resin, having lowered hardness and enhanced flexibility, without exerting undesirable influence on other properties, by the graft-polymerization of a specified rubber latex, in the presence of a specified radical polymerization initiator, under specified conditions.
CONSTITUTION: At least one vinyl aromatic compound monomer (A) and at least one vinyl cyanide compound monomer (B), and, if necessary, at least one (meth) acrylate monomer (C), are graft-polymerized with a rubber polymer latex, which contains at least 50wt% of particles having particle size of ≥0.3μ, in such proportions that the weight ratio of the solid rubber polymer in the latex to the total of A, B and C, is 15:85W35:65. 140% or higher degree of grafting is attained by using, as a radical polymerization initiator, a redox initiator, composed of an organic peroxide and a water-soluble iron salt, and by continuously adding the total amount of said monomers A, B and C and the initiator, to the reaction system. Thereby hardness is lowered and secondary workability is enhanced as compared with those of a conventional ABS resin.
